CATERING STAFF

Daytime, weekend and early evening shifts available

You'll provide high quality customer service, preparing and serving hot and cold food and drinks in our catering outlets including Rectors' Café and the Old Union Coffee Shop. Various shifts are available, but applicants should be flexible and available to work various shifts. Barista experience is helpful but training will be given.

 

 

CASUAL BAR/EVENT STAFF

Late evening or occasional work

Providing high-quality customer service in our busy bars, within the Association and/or at outside events, you will be part of an award-winning team serving alcoholic and non-alcoholic drinks and food. Training in responsible alcohol service will be given.

  • Your duties will include the sale & preparation of food & drinks, associated restocking, collecting & washing of glassware, as well as bar-related cleaning/housekeeping. You may also be involved with the running of our cloakroom & hosting our karaoke nights. We provide bars throughout the year for external events, and you may be involved with the setup or takedown of these events. 

  • The current rate of pay for Casual Bar staff is £12.21/hr, with an additional 12% included in your hourly rate in lieu of holiday pay, paid monthly in arrears. 

  • You can expect to work on average 2-3 shifts each week during term-time, though we can be flexible when it comes to your deadlines/exams. 

  • Please be aware that the Union Bars shut over the Christmas Break, and that there will be very few/no shifts available during Independent Learning Weeks and the Summer Vacation.
